1.WAKE UP!
DREAM:IN explores dreams and works towards realizing them. It aims to explore each individual - across age, class and income groups. Here ideas are born. Ideas that are big, original and exciting to many potential stakeholders. An optimistic yet rational demonstration that dreams can be captured and converted into reality. The DREAM:IN 1.0 experience was in Bangalore, India, in January-March 2011, consisting of the DREAM:IN Journey and the DREAM:IN Conclave. Ten days, 101 DreamCatchers, hundreds of places, thousands of dreams... On the 9th and 10th of January, 101 students and young professionals from various fields set out in 11 teams on the first-ever DREAM:IN Journey. They travelled across India by rail and road through cities, towns and villages, into the homes and lives of Indians to learn about and capture dreams of India. DREAM:IN Conclave brought together a diverse group of Indian and international people-of talent, skill and mind. Big dreamers shared their personal vision and their dream for India. Design thinking experts helped channel thoughts and actions. Entrepreneurs lent their mercurial ability to take ideas forward.

DREAM:IN JOURNEY 1.0 8th - 17th Jan 2011


A search for meaning, a journey to unknown places, going wide across a nation and a land, to meet, to know people and find out what they are dreaming about. The DREAM:IN Journey is a patented methodology that trains volunteers in the art of DreamCatching (a tool that is a combination of film making, ethnography, creative thinking and communicating developed and owned by DREAM:IN) and then sending the volunteers on a journey across a country/ region to capture and record the dreams of people. DREAM:IN was launched with the DREAM:IN Journey 2011. On the 9th and 10th of January, 101 DreamCatchers, students from 19 institutions across the country, set out in 11 teams on the first-ever DREAM:IN Journey. The 8-day journeys on 11 different routes took them over 25,000 kilometres across the length and breadth of India to capture on video, Indias very real dreams. Grand Rapids, USA. 2.3. DREAM:IN METHOD/ TOOLS


A radical design thinking methodology that works inside out to unlock the potential of people and create innovative solutions and lasting value. For enterprise and society. Creating relevant and current themes and designing the comprehensive plan for each journey - across nations, across constituencies.

2.3.1.1. DreamCatchingTM wheel


DreamCatching is a unique frame of enquiry that helps unveil the fears and anxieties, wishes and desires and the deepest real aspirations of the subject. Investigates what people are dreaming about and records their most meaningful dreams. Dreamcatching is a tried, tested and patented methodology that was created by the DREAM:IN team. Dreamcatching is a combination of the DREAM:IN Methodology, Ethnography, Sociology, Film making, Creative thinking and writing. Dreamcatching training is given to students before they set out on a DREAM:IN journey or camp. It is a flexible methodology can be customised. The DreamCatching Method helps to investigate what people are dreaming, understand their dream levels and record their most meaningful dreams. The Leader is the coach of the group. The Spotter catches the people we are looking for, based on a guideline given and talks to them! The Framer captures our dreamer in his context and catches moving footage. The Reader is the writer, who is concerned with catching the essence of every interaction making each one of them meaningful.

2.3.1. DREAM:IN JOURNEY


A DREAM:IN Journey is typically a 12 day journey across a geography, with two days of training and 10 days of travel, taking DreamCatchers, equipped with the DreamCatching kit and video cameras to meet and interview a diverse cross section of people and, in turn, recording their dreams. 2.3.1.2. DreamCatchingTM cards


These cards are used to put those who are interviwed at ease and to enable them to get beyond their needs and problems towards identifying their aspirations and creative dreams.

2.3.1.4. DreamSequenceTM
The Dream sequence is the intro and outro (including dream information, graphics and music) before any dream. The Dream Sequence in total lasts about 10 seconds and is a pre-view to any dream captured by DREAM:IN.

2.3.1.3. DreamCatchingTM board


This is a signature board used to record the identity, location and other immediate details of the person interviewed by the Dreamcatchers.

2.3.1.5. DreamCapsuleTM
A Dreamcapsule would typically be defined as an interview of a person captured on video (or in text form) using the DreamCatching methodology developed by DREAM:IN. DREAM:IN captures dreams on videos. A typical dream video would be approximately 1 3 min long, subtitled with English text and have the DREAM:IN watermark.

A Youth Journey and a pilot for the DREAM:In Next Generation Enterprise across youth catchments in Karnataka, Tamil Nadu, Andhra Pradesh, Maharashtra & Kerala, to identify youth enterprise dreams. The intent is to capture 10,000 dreams of which 100 would be shortlisted and shaped into scenarios and plans. On an average it is envisaged that about 75 of these to be ideas/ ventures in the pre-entrepreneur stage, 20 in the budding entrepreneur stage and 5 in the emerging entrepreneur stage. The entire time taken for the journey, selection, short listing, mentoring and the creation of business plan will be a 3 month process culminating in the DREAM:IN Conclave where these ideas and enterprises will be presented to a number of potential investors.

TUMKUR

The DREAM:IN Tumkur project began as the result of three different agendas, streamlining in to one solution - the DREAM:IN Global academic program, the conversation with the National Innovation Council and the conversation with Manipal Foundation about Tumkur. This lead to the start of this prototype of a bottom up developmental model in the district of Tumkur.

34

DREAM:IN SOCIAL NETWORKS PVT. LTD. 2012. ALL RIGHTS RESERVED

THIS DOCUMENT IS CONFIDENTIAL AND PROPRIETARY

35

www.dreamin.in

After a successful DREAM:IN journey and conclave in 2011, a plan for scaling up this model was taken to the National Innovation Council in New Delhi. Upon discussion of the plan with Mr. Pitroda and his team, the idea of implementing DREAM:IN on a district level came up. quoting Mr. Pitroda, he said that there are several initiatives across the country that are boiling the water, creating ideas and plans, but no one to actually go forth and take them through to reality. If DREAM:IN were to successfully implement its model on a district level, show successes and implement solutions and ventures, then the National Innovation Council would fund and support similar projects being implemented across the rest of the 639 districts across India. The DREAM:IN Global Academic Program in partnership with the NICC, Bangalore, which provided 13 students for the project telescoped into the DREAM:IN Tumkur project with Manipal Foundation coming in as a key partner. While scoping out a number of possible regions where DREAM:IN could be implemented, Mr Balachandran Warrier, CEO of Manipal Foundation, suggested that Tumkur would be an ideal district to map. The Dream Journey could be undertaken through the 10 taluks of Tumkur district which has strategic potential for 360 degree development because of its proximity to Bangalore. It would be a good beginning to map the district and identify potential social and business ventures. Awareness was spread about the Dream:In Tumkur project across many layers of society and help began coming in from friends in Tumkur the hostel where the students would be put up, transportation, specific contacts in the taluks to enable ease of Dreamcatching on the journey, pointers from influencers in the district, etc. The base was thus laid for a successful Dream Journey, two Dreamscaping sessions and the concluding Dream:In Tumkur Conclave. The SIT MBA Department provided the Dream:In Tumkur project with their auditorium for the Dream:In Conclave on June 05 2012.

The event kick started at the Kellen auditorium with videos of interviews done during the DREAM:IN Journey. Meu Sonho Verde - Green Dreams Around the World - May 2011

This initiatives goal was Green Dreams Around the World and was officially presented on the last day of the International Conference of Innovative Cities (CICI 2011), conducted by the Federation of Industries of Paran (FIEP). The idea was inspired by the DREAM:IN project held in Bangalore (India). The United Nations Institute for Training and Research (UNITAR) requested the managing committee of International Training Centre for Local Actors in Latin America (CIFAL), which is coordinated locally by Fiep and located in Curitiba, for this initiative. The CIFAL was given the responsibility to create the pilot project. It was aimed at mobilisation with the theme of environment and sustainability, and a characteristic ability to be replicated, in order to be adopted by other cities around the world. The pilot projects focus was to rally support from the streets of the Curitiba towards the green dreams of the population. For this, a team of 85 dream catchers were equipped with mobile phones and digital cameras, to collect testimonies on videofor about a minute. The materials intent is to feed the global discussion on the future of the planet.Rio will be the centre of world attention exactly one year from now, when the United Nations Conference on Sustainable Development (Rio+20), which occurs 20 years after the Eco 92, will be held. Sonia Manchanda presented the Indian dreams captured inBangalorefor the Dream-in project, which served as inspiration for Curitiba. Over a thousand testimonies were captured from across India. The ordinary people spoke about their personal dreams for a better life. Thinkers from across citiespublic administrators, planners, engineers, managers, entrepreneurs, financiers, academicsproposed to draw public, social, environmental and business-based policies on these dreams.

Sonia spoke about Bangalore becoming an innovation hub, the importance of DREAM:IN, the use of design thinking in India today and DREAM:IN DREAM:IN At Bharati Vidyapeeth The Bharati Vidhyapeeth, Pune, evolving from a 1964 vision of Dr Patangrao Kadam to build a complex of educational institutions to bring about social transformation through dynamic education, asked Idiom to initiate a re-branding exercise as the prelude to celebrating its 50 years in education. Bharati Vidyapeeth boasts more than 78 schools and 60 institutions of higher education offering conventional, professional and non-conventional disciplines as a deemed university and in affiliations with State universities. Idiom resorted to its pioneering DREAM:IN Methodology to get a multi-dimensional fix on the Bharati Vidyapeeth culture and parivar. The primary research task involved six Dreamcatchers from Idiom spanning out across eight Bharati Vidyapeeth campuses in Pune, Sangli, Kohlapur and Navi Mumbai, capturing on video the dreams of students, deans, professors and non-teaching staff. The Dreamers on the BV campuses provided snapshots of their experiences with the institution, its traditions and heritage, aspects of pride, deep-rooted values, a series of associative images (animal or bird or color or object) that demonstrated their perception of their institution and, finally, the articulation of their Dreams or aspirations for Bharati Vidyapeeth 50 years in the future. The DreamCatching exercise enabled Idiom to put together a composite picture of a giant educational institution looking to being cutting-edge, contemporary and futuristic in a sampler video to be followed by the creation of dream capsules which will be used to trigger creative approaches that BV can take at a forthcoming Dream Conclave, an intense workshop that will use tools like DreamScaping to shape the future of Bharati Vidyapeeth. 54 55
